Methanolothermale Synthese und Kristallstruktur von Diselenido- und Ditelluridogermanaten(IV) der Alkalimetalle K – Cs / M ethanolothermal Synthesis and Crystal Structure of Diselenido- and Ditelluridogerm anates(IV) of the Alkali Metals K – Cs

  • W. S. Sheldrick and B. Schaaf

Methanolothermal reaction of M2CO3 (M = K, Rb) with Ge and Se yields respectively the diselenidogermanates(IV) K2GeSe4 and Rb2GeSe4, both of which contain chain anions 1[GeSe42-] in which GeSe4 tetrahedra are linked via Se-Se bonds. A similar structural principle is found in the ditelluridogermanates(IV) Rb2GeTe4 and Cs2GeTe4, prepared by reaction of M2CO3 (M = Rb, Cs) with Ge and Te in methanol at temperatures of respectively 200 and 160 °C. The effect of cation size on the chain conformation is discussed. Rb4Ge4Se10 · CH3OH, which is formed together with Rb2GeSe4, exhibits isolated anions [Ge4Se10]4- with an adamantane-like structure.
